Practical Ways to Simplify Your Digital Routine
Reducing complexity online isn’t just about the tools we use; it also comes down to habits. Here are some practical steps that anyone can apply to make their digital life more manageable:
- Curate your content feeds to only follow sources that add value or joy to your day.
- Limit notifications on apps that distract you unnecessarily.
- Use trusted platforms that prioritize user experience and privacy.
- Organize bookmarks and frequently used resources in a clean, accessible way.
- Set time boundaries for online activities to prevent exhaustion.
Interestingly, many people find that after making these changes, their focus and productivity improve markedly. It’s a matter of reclaiming control over digital spaces, rather than letting these spaces control us.
